Grisport Maranello Waterproof Boots Safety Black S3 with Certification SR,SRC

Features:

  • Waterproof S3 safety boot
  • Water-repellent with 200J toe protection
  • Flexible metal and puncture-resistant sole
  • Anti-slip with kevlar
  • Heel support system
  • Sole with antistatic Dakar leather

    It is a mediocre shoe for 75-90€, not more. That's how much I get them for. I have bought them twice and they last for a year with full use on the construction site. They have zero water resistance. Zero. Even slippers have more water resistance. To understand, I happened to step on grass with morning dew and my foot got soaked after 4-5 months of use. If you want waterproof, don't get these.

    It is the fifth time I buy them..!
    In general, they last me about 1.5 years with daily use. And I don't change them because they break, I change them because the sole wears out after 1.5 years and I'm afraid it might slip.
    I wash them about 4 times a year in the washing machine.
    I never had any problems,
    They don't slip, and they are generally comfortable although a bit heavy..
    Lately, I also use gel insoles and they are even more comfortable.!
    I bought the first pair for 65€ 6 years ago and as time goes by, unfortunately, the selling price keeps increasing, now it has reached 105€

    The most comfortable work shoes I have ever worn!
    Non-slip, sturdy shoes!
    After about 2 years, they started to open on the sides, but not completely, they have some layers.
    I bought the Cofra shoes after these, they didn't even last a year before completely opening on the side and the sole of the right shoe cracked.
    Luckily, I hadn't thrown away the Grisport shoes and they served me until I bought new ones.
    After this change, I realized how much more comfortable the Maranello shoes are. Generally, due to work, I don't keep shoes for long, they become useless over time, but this one lasted longer than all the others so far.

    COMFORT: 10
    SLIP RESISTANCE: 9.5
    DURABILITY: 9
    WATERPROOF: 8.5
